Lily Edwards Dr. Lily Edwards is an assistant professor of animal behavior and welfare at Kansas State University. She obtained a B.A. in French from Amherst College in 2002. After teaching in Belgium for a year after graduating, she decided to continue her education in Animal Science. She received her M.S from the university of Rhode Island in 2006 studying behavior and welfare of captive zoo species. She completed her Ph.D. at Colorado State University in 2009 focusing on understanding and minimizing pre-slaughter stress of swine. At KSU, Dr. Edwards conducts research, advises students and teaches courses in animal behavior, welfare and ethical issues in agriculture.
